I started digging into the support documents. Buried in the good print was a disclaimer. It said the tool could isolated display media that had been "indexed" by their servers. In plain English, that means if the person was ever public, they had the photos. If they were always private, the tool was useless.
This is the veracity of Instagram tracking tools. They aren't actually "hacking" Instagram. They are just giant databases of scraped information. They wait for a profile to go public for five minutes. They grind down everything. Then, past the profile goes private again, they "sell" that entry put up to to you. I felt gone a sum amateur. I had fallen for a glorified archive.

Key Takeaways from My fruitless Experiment
- There is no magic button. Security is tall for a reason.
- Paid subscriptions are often better-looking scams. Professional design does not equal a professional product.
- Cache is not rouse data. Most tools just take effect you what used to be public.
- Your data is at risk. Using these tools exposes your username and potentially your savings account card info to shady actors.
- Acceptance is cheaper. It costs zero dollars to end caring what a private account is doing.
